Installation of Fiber Optic Temperature Sensor

Installing a fiber optic temperature sensor involves selecting the right sensor, securing it at the measurement point, routing the fiber carefully, and calibrating the system for accurate readings.

Step 1: Selecting the Right Sensor

Choose a sensor based on your application requirements, including temperature range, accuracy, and environmental conditions. Fiber optic sensors can be intrinsic, where the fiber itself measures temperature, or extrinsic, where an external material is used to detect temperature changes (FZ Inno) .

Step 2: Preparing the Installation Site

  • Identify the measurement point, such as the hottest spot in a transformer winding or a critical area in industrial equipment (FISO) .
  • Ensure the surface is clean, dry, and free from contaminants if using adhesives or tapes (Sensuron) .
  • Avoid sharp bends in the fiber; maintain the minimum bending radius specified by the manufacturer to prevent signal loss or fiber damage .

Step 3: Securing the Sensor

  • For transformer applications, use EasyDisk spacers or similar anchoring methods to hold the sensor tip in place without crushing it during operation (FISO) .
  • For surface installations, adhesives like M-Bond 200, AE-10, or RTV silicone can be used to attach the fiber to the surface (Sensuron) .
  • Temporary or non-critical applications can use double-sided tape, but it is less reliable under environmental stress .

Step 4: Routing the Fiber Cable

  • Route the fiber along a safe path, avoiding sharp bends and mechanical stress points.
  • Leave slack in the cable to accommodate movement or thermal expansion. Coiling 20–30 cm loops can help manage excess length (FISO) .
  • Secure the cable to supporting structures using cotton strapping or cable ties, ensuring it does not interfere with moving parts .

Step 5: Connecting and Calibrating

  • Connect the fiber to the data acquisition system or photodetector using the appropriate connectors .
  • Calibrate the sensor according to the manufacturer's instructions to ensure accurate temperature readings. This may involve adjusting parameters to match the expected temperature range .

Step 6: Testing and Maintenance

  • Test the sensor after installation to verify proper operation and signal integrity.
  • Regularly inspect the fiber for damage, kinks, or environmental degradation, and replace worn components as needed .
  • Ensure the sensor remains protected from moisture, chemicals, or mechanical stress that could affect performance . By following these steps, you can ensure a reliable and accurate installation of fiber optic temperature sensors for industrial, environmental, or laboratory applications.
